City, County Offices Closed For MLK Day

The City Commission meeting will be held Tuesday, Jan. 22.

Sarasota city and county administrative offices will be closed Monday, Jan. 21, to observe Martin Luther King, Jr. Day.

Sarasota City Commission's meeting will be held Tuesday, Jan. 22 at 2:30 p.m. and 6 p.m. at City Hall. 

Weekly garbage and recycling collection will not be affected.

Sarasota County Area Transit and Manatee County Area Transit will be on a normal bus schedule on Jan. 21.

All Sarasota County libraries will be closed.

All Sarasota County recreation centers will be closed, with the exception of the following:

  • Arlington Park Recreation Center, open noon-5 p.m.
  • Payne Park Tennis Center, open 7:30 a.m.-9 p.m. 

The collection schedule for solid waste, yard waste and recyclables will not be affected by the holiday and remains on the regular pickup schedule, with no interruption of collection.

  • The landfill at 4000 Knights Trail Road in Nokomis will be open, but the administrative office will be closed.
  • The gun range at Knight Trail Park will be closed.

Sarasota County's chemical collection centers at 8750 Bee Ridge Road, Sarasota; and 250 S. Jackson Road, Venice, will be closed; however, the Citizen's Convenience Center at 4010 Knights Trail Road, Nokomis, will be open.
